We first have to understand that recoveries from accidents are going to vary based off of several different factors, such as insurance policies, health bills, wages lost, punitive damages, and other factors that can arise from a deposition or a court case if the claim goes to trial. Here is a breakdown of several different factors that can determine how much your truck accident claim is worth:
- Insurance Policy – Insurance Policies will often have maximum limits that are set in accordance with the policy, accident or the severity of the accident. These limits are often in the ten’s of thousands, but can be upwards of a million dollars in accidents involving a fatality.
- Medical Bills – If you incurred medical bills from an accident and the accident was not your fault, you are not liable for the payment of those bills. Either the others party’s insurance or your insurance can be held liable for the medical bills. Often, they will tell you that they will only pay “X” amount of the bills and that you will have to cover the rest, but this is not correct and is false. You can sue the other insurance company or even your own if they are refusing to cooperate, and guess what, when you take an insurance company to court they are almost always willing to pay more than they initially offered.

- Reaccuring Medical Bills and Fees – Sometimes injuries have lasting damages and require months if not years of medical attention. The costs of either the medicine, the rehab, or the multiple surgeries can be astronomical and often far beyond the means of anyone to pay alone. These costs can further what your truck accident claim may be worth, and remember, you are owed these amounts. You didn’t cause your accident, so you shouldn’t have to pay for it.
- Death – No amount of money will ever equal the worth of someone’s life. When death is involved, any claim, whether it’s a car accident, truck accident, or a workers’ compensation claim will almost always be near the $1,000,000 range. Insurance companies carry policy maximums for death that typically are around the million dollar mark. If your claim involves a death, it is possible that your family could recover this amount.
- Damages to Vehicle – Any damages to your vehicle can be recovered, this includes if your vehicle was totaled. Insurance policies will typically dictate what a vehicle is worth and what you can recover for the vehicle.
